AI Analysis — Bull vs Bear

Anthropic anthropic claude-opus-4.6 3d ago
HOLD
Risk medium

City Union Bank trades at a reasonable PE of 14.8x with consistent 13% ROE over 3, 5, and 10 years, but low sales growth of 10.7% over 5 years and significant contingent liabilities of Rs.10,792 Cr warrant caution. The stock's 37% 1-year CAGR has priced in near-term positives, making risk-reward balanced at current levels.

Bull Case 8
  • Strong analyst consensus with 87.5% buy ratings (21 out of 24 analysts recommending buy)
  • Attractive valuation at PE of 14.8x, below the banking sector average of 18-20x for mid-sized banks
  • Consistent ROE of 13% maintained across 3-year, 5-year, and 10-year periods showing earnings stability
  • Accelerating revenue growth with TTM sales growth of 18% vs 5-year CAGR of only 11%
  • Compounded profit growth of 18% TTM indicates improving profitability trajectory
  • Working capital days reduced from 180 days to 138 days, showing improved operational efficiency
  • Reasonable Price-to-Book of 1.86x for a bank delivering consistent 13% ROE
  • Stock CAGR of 37% over 1 year reflects strong momentum and re-rating potential
Bear Case 8
  • Low interest coverage ratio raises concerns about debt servicing ability in a rising rate environment
  • Contingent liabilities of Rs.10,792 Cr are significant relative to market cap of Rs.19,720 Cr (55% of market cap)
  • Poor sales growth of only 10.7% over past 5 years suggests limited franchise expansion
  • Low return on equity of 12.9% over last 3 years, below the 15%+ benchmark for quality banks
  • Dividend payout of only 11.8% of profits over last 3 years with a yield of just 1.01% offers poor income return
  • Possible capitalization of interest costs may be flattering reported profitability
  • 10-year stock CAGR of only 11% indicates prolonged periods of underperformance historically
  • 5-year stock CAGR of just 10% versus 5-year profit CAGR of 17% suggests persistent valuation compression risk

AI News Digest

Anthropic anthropic claude-opus-4.6 14h ago
Headwinds 2
  • Stock down 12.3% YTD Jun 11

    City Union Bank shares have declined 12.3% since the beginning of 2026, closing at ₹253.3 per share with market cap of ₹18,822 crore.

  • ₹500 crore QIP dilution planned Jun 24

    Board proposed ₹500 crore capital raise via QIP, requiring shareholder approval at AGM on August 14, 2026, which will dilute existing holdings.

Positives 5
  • 1:3 bonus issue allotted Jun 15

    City Union Bank allotted 24.77 crore bonus shares in a 1:3 ratio, the first bonus issue in eight years since 2018. Shares listed on June 16, 2026.

  • 200% dividend approved for FY26 Jun 24

    Board approved 200% dividend of ₹2 per share for FY26, with record date July 31 and payment on or after August 14, 2026.

  • Highest 555-day FD at 7.25% Jun 15

    City Union Bank offers the highest 555-day FD rate among peers at 7.25% for general customers and 7.50% for senior citizens, potentially aiding deposit mobilization.

  • Key appointments approved overwhelmingly May 31

    Shareholders approved R Mohan as Independent Director with 92% votes in favour and bonus issue with 97% approval via postal ballot.

  • 23% one-year stock return Jun 11

    Despite YTD weakness, the stock has delivered 23% returns over one year with ROE at 14.94%.

Neutral 3
  • Trading window closed from Jul 1 Jun 20

    Trading window closed from July 1, 2026, until Q1FY27 results are declared; designated persons cannot trade CUB equity during this period.

  • ₹36.81 crore NSE block trade Jun 10

    Block trade of approximately 14.54 lakh shares executed at ₹253.20 per share on NSE, totaling ₹36.81 crore, likely institutional activity.

  • Singapore investor meet participation Jun 4

    City Union Bank participated in India Corporate Day Singapore 2026 on June 9, organized by Kotak Institutional Equities.

TL;DR: City Union Bank is executing a series of shareholder-friendly actions — a 1:3 bonus issue (first in 8 years), 200% dividend, and competitive deposit rates — signaling confidence in its financial health with 14.94% ROE. The proposed ₹500 crore QIP introduces near-term dilution risk, and the stock remains weak YTD (-12.3%) despite strong one-year returns. The trend is cautiously improving as capital actions and governance moves suggest management is positioning for growth, but QIP execution and Q1FY27 results will be key catalysts to watch.
